Allen Jackson Rowe was born in 1800 in Edgefield, Edgefield, South Carolina, USA, the child of Captain William Rowe And Mary Ann Oneal 4Ggm. In 1850, Allen Jackson Rowe resided in Division 59, Meriwether, Georgia, USA. Allen Jackson Rowe married Huldah Rebecca Rowe, Mary Rowe, and had children including Andrew Jackson Rowe, Emma Lenorah Spence, Francis E Rowe, John Morgan Rowe, Martha Narcissa Cansler, Mary A E Rowe, Richard Lewis Rowe, Sarah Allen Smith, Thomas Jefferson Rowe, Virginia Lee Sewell, William Rowe B. Allen Jackson Rowe passed away in 1885 in Carroll County, Georgia, United States of America.
